If you need nursing grants to help cover your education, you will first have to file for the Free Application for Federal Student Aid. This is the starting point for applying for any financial help. After filling out the application, you can talk with a counselor about the different types of grants available for financial aid.
Because nurses are in high demand, there are many financial aid options available from universities and the government. First, you’ll need to fill out the Free Application for Federal Student Aid, and then you can meet with a counselor to determine other grants you can apply for and how much these grants will contribute. For every year that you’ll need financial assistance, you’ll need to fill out a new FAFSA. It should be noted that the amount of financial assistance you’ll be eligible for may fluctuate from year to year.
